I am getting a bit annoyed at the Layers Panel or perhaps it’s just the lousy interface in general as people seem to be ranting about. This might happen with you other folks. So, try the following:
1. In the CS4 menu, choose Window > Workspace > Web. The workspace will change accordingly. Take note that the Layer Panel is open and visible on the right pane.
2. Minimize and then Maximize CS4.
Did your Layers Panel collapse to the very bottom? If so, try the following…
3. Uncollapsing the Layers Panel so it is visible again.
4. Minimize and then Maximize CS4 again.
Did the Layers Panel collapse again? Did for me and everytime I tried it.
Pretty annoying I must admit.
